Bonus Math
Understanding bonus math is crucial to maximize your value. Let’s say a welcome bonus offers a 100% match up to $200, with a 20x wagering requirement on the bonus amount. If you deposit $100, you receive a $100 bonus, making your total bankroll $200. The wagering requirement is 20 x $100 = $2,000. You must wager $2,000 before you can withdraw any winnings from the bonus.
Now, consider the house edge. Suppose you play a slot with a 96% RTP (Return to Player), meaning the house edge is 4%. Over the long run, for every $100 wagered, you can expect to lose $4. To clear the $2,000 wagering requirement, your expected loss is 4% of $2,000 = $80. So, from your initial $100 deposit, you might end with approximately $20 in bonus winnings, but this is before accounting for variance. In practice, you could win or lose more, but the math shows the true cost of the bonus.
If the wagering requirement is on the deposit + bonus (which is common), the calculation changes. For a $100 deposit + $100 bonus, the requirement is 20 x ($100 + $100) = $4,000. Expected loss at 4% house edge = $160, which exceeds your initial outlay of $100, making it a losing proposition on average. Always read the terms carefully to know exactly how to calculate your expected value.
Another factor is game contributions. Slots often contribute 100% to wagering, while table games may contribute only 10% or less. If you play blackjack, you would need to wager ten times more to clear the same requirement. For example, if you wager $100 on blackjack, it only counts as $10 towards the requirement. That means you need to bet $20,000 on blackjack to clear a $2,000 requirement, which is a huge disadvantage.
Payment Methods
Choosing the right payment method affects your convenience and withdrawal speed. Here is a comparison of common options available to players, including those in Ontario.
| Method | Deposit Time | Withdrawal Time | Fees |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Credit/Debit Card (Visa, Mastercard) | Instant | 2-5 business days | No fee for deposits, but some banks may charge cash advance fees | Widely accepted; ensure your card allows gambling transactions. |
| E-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ller) | Instant | Under 24 hours | No fee, but e-wallet may have its own charges | Fast and convenient; check if e-wallets are accepted for bonuses. |
| Bank Transfer | 1-3 business days | 3-7 business days | Possible fees from both sides | Slower but reliable for larger amounts. |
| Prepaid Cards (Paysafecard) | Instant | Not available for withdrawals | Small purchase fee | Good for deposits, but you need another method to cash out. |
| Cryptocurrency (if offered) | Instant | Within hours | May have network fees | Opt for privacy and speed; check volatility risks. |
